Joe Jarzombek is the Director for Software Assurance within the Office of Cyber Security and Communications (CS&C) of the Department of Homeland Security. In this role he leads government interagency efforts with industry, academia, and standards organizations in addressing security needs in work force education and training, more comprehensive diagnostic capabilities, and security-enhanced development and acquisition practices
